The beautiful 200 acres of stunning gardens at Exbury, nr. Southampton, is the Club’s garden trip this Spring. We’ll see the famous Rhododendrons and Azaleas, for which Exbury is famous, at their peak. Many other types of plantings are also to be enjoyed, just by wandering the many well surfaced pathways. For those that do not wish to walk far there are the options of a buggy ride and the Steam Train, at a small additional cost. (c.£3.00). The train journey takes you to a separate part of the garden which is not otherwise seen.
Lunch can be enjoyed in the excellent restaurant and plants can be purchased at the garden centre.We’ll then drive into the New Forest to enjoy an afternoon cream tea at Burley, which is included in the cost, but can be opted out of for a saving of £4.00 – (our bulk buying discount saves us 50p. per cream tea, off the normal cost of £4.50, if ordered in advance).
Leaving Lytchett Village Hall at 09.00 on 26 April, to arrive at c.10.15, we’ll leave at 14.00 to visit a New Forest tea room for an included cream tea. We expect to return home by 17.30. £24 including Exbury Gardens’ entrance and your cream tea.
